Types of Cryptocurrency Wallets
Alright, let’s break this down into digestible bits. When it comes to crypto wallets, you’ll primarily encounter two types: hot wallets and cold wallets.
- Hot wallets: These are connected to the internet, making them incredibly convenient for everyday transactions. Think of them as online banking. However, that connection also makes them more vulnerable to hacks. If you’re the type who loves instant access to your funds, a hot wallet might be your go-to.
- Cold wallets: These are offline storage solutions, like a safe tucked away in a bank. They offer enhanced security, making them much harder to reach for hackers. However, they can be a bit less user-friendly. If you’re serious about holding your crypto long-term, a cold wallet is worth considering.
But wait, there’s more! Within these categories, you’ll find various formats. Think software wallets (easy to use but riskier), hardware wallets (secure, physical devices), and even paper wallets (where you write down your keys—simple but iffy if you misplace that paper).
Choosing the Right Wallet: A Beginner’s Approach
Now that we’ve covered the basics, how do you choose the right wallet? Here are a few factors to keep in mind:
- Security Features: Look for wallets that offer two-factor authentication and encryption.
- User-Friendliness: If you’re just starting out, you want a wallet that doesn’t make you pull your hair out.
- Accessibility: How often will you need to access your funds? This can influence your choice between hot and cold wallets.
Some popular wallets for beginners include Coinbase Wallet and Exodus for hot wallets, while Ledger Nano S and Trezor are excellent cold wallet options. Personally, I started with Exodus due to its intuitive interface and ease of access, and I’ve been happy with it so far.
Understanding the Risks of Crypto Wallets
Unfortunately, it’s not all rainbows and butterflies in the crypto world. Like any digital asset, wallets come with risks. Hacking is a big one—you hear stories of people losing their life savings in an instant. Phishing attacks are also rampant; you get an email that looks legit, and before you know it, your funds are gone.
There have been real-life examples that make this all too real. Take the infamous Mt. Gox incident, where hackers made off with 850,000 Bitcoin. That kind of loss is heartbreaking! And it underscores the point that understanding crypto wallet risks can save you from sleepless nights.
Practical Security Tips for Beginners
Let’s pivot to some practical advice on how to secure cryptocurrency:
- Strong Passwords: This might sound basic, but use long, unique passwords that mix letters, numbers, and symbols.
- Two-Factor Authentication: Always enable this feature—it’s like having a second key for your vault.
- Backup Strategies: Regularly back up your wallet. Whether that means saving recovery phrases or using external drives, make sure you’re prepared.
Here’s my personal security checklist that I follow:
- Change passwords regularly—at least every few months.
- Keep software and apps updated.
- Avoid clicking links in unsolicited emails.
